BIOGRAPHY

James Williams is a notable figure in the realm of documentary filmmaking, best known for his compelling 2009 work, "Clough: The Brian Clough Story." This film not only chronicles the life of one of football's most charismatic managers but also delves into the cultural significance of Clough's tenure at Nottingham Forest. Collectors seek out this title for its unique blend of sports history and personal storytelling, making it a must-have in any serious film library. Williams's directorial style captures the essence of his subjects, and the engaging narrative of "Clough" has earned it a special place among collectors who appreciate films that transcend their genre. The film's limited edition releases on Blu-ray and DVD are particularly sought after, as they often feature exclusive interviews and behind-the-scenes content that enrich the viewing experience. For collectors passionate about sports documentaries and the impact of cinema on cultural narratives, James Williams's work is both a valuable addition and a celebration of the stories that shape our world.
